74ACT11245
description
The octal bus transceiver is designed for asynchronous two-way munication between data buses. The control-function implementation minimizes external timing requirements.
The device allows data transmission from the A bus to the B bus or from the B bus to the A bus, depending on the logic level at the direction-control (DIR) input. The output-enable (OE) input can be used to disable the device so that the buses are effectively isolated.
The 74ACT11245 is characterized for operation from
- 40°C to 85°C.
